Abstract

This paper analyzes a relation between level of total production inventory and effective production capacity in a production process, and proposes a method of controlling effective production capacity in a business fluctuations period. They are based on the property: “effective production capacity = capacity of production facilities - total changeover loss", where changeover loss is a decreasing function of level of total production inventory.
Although the effective production capacity can be controlled by an increase or decrease of production facilities, its cost is too expensive. It must be done only in the case that an increase or decrease in demand is confirmed. Therefore, the effective production capacity must be controlled by the level of total inventory.
In a business recovery or recession period, two kinds of production time have to be controlled. The first the production-time control for the increase or decrease in demand, and the second is that for an increase or decrease in the level of total inventory. Even if an increasing or decreasing rate in demand is constant, the value of the total control time decreases at first and then increases exponentially. This is the reason why inventory control is difficult in a business fluctuations period.
